Senior Quantity Surveyor
CurrentReview design and material specifications in the design packages to accurately determine amount of materials / quantifying the same. Carry out the daily valuations and cost estimate of work in progress and tender invitations related civil works. Keep track of materials and ordering more when required. Prepare the Bill of Items from the Approved Shop Drawings. Arrange the joint quantity measurement with consultant and sub-contractor for the progress bill. Prepare detailed specifications and obtain the estimates of additional cost from the estimation department in case of a variation. Prepare final accounts once the job is completed, coordinate with the site engineer to confirm all works are estimated, prepare and attach necessary supporting documents, obtain approval of the PM and receive a payment certificate from the client in order to enable the company to collect the outstanding amount on the due date. Attend all internal and external pre-commencement, progress and contract review meetings. Requesting quotations from different suppliers/manufactures and ensuring fast a fast reply from those. Prepare the payment certificates for sub-contractors once value certificates are received and based on the jobs completed; arrange to pay them according to terms specified in their contracts. Prepare Sub contractors Liabilities Sheet. Discuss and attempt to reach mutual agreement with the Contractor on rates for new work items that are not covered in the Bill of Quantities. Ensure application of retention in the interim payments and reduction of the same in the final payment as per the contract’s requirements. Check all quantities of subcontractor accounts, re-measure all work carried out and administer the contract and handle all re-measurement, variations, pricing updates and procurement issues.
